Attendance in Stamford Public Schools has grown by nearly 5,000 new students in the past fifteen years and more growth is expected in the future. Today, Stamford’s delegation to the General Assembly announced that they have secured funding for a critical expansion of the Rogers International Inter-District Magnet School which will help meet the growing demand for classroom space in the city.
